      7 The @code{autopoint} program copies standard gettext infrastructure files
      8 into a source package.  It extracts from a macro call of the form
      9 @code{AM_GNU_GETTEXT_VERSION(@var{version})}, found in the package's
     10 @file{configure.in} or @file{configure.ac} file, the gettext version
     11 used by the package, and copies the infrastructure files belonging to
     12 this version into the package.

     46 @code{autopoint} supports the GNU @code{gettext} versions from 0.10.35 to
     47 the current one, @value{VERSION}.  In order to apply @code{autopoint} to
     48 a package using a @code{gettext} version newer than @value{VERSION}, you
     49 need to install this same version of GNU @code{gettext} at least.
     50 
     51 In packages using GNU @code{automake}, an invocation of @code{autopoint}
     52 should be followed by invocations of @code{aclocal} and then @code{autoconf}
     53 and @code{autoheader}.  The reason is that @code{autopoint} installs some
     54 autoconf macro files, which are used by @code{aclocal} to create
     55 @file{aclocal.m4}, and the latter is used by @code{autoconf} to create the
     56 package's @file{configure} script and by @code{autoheader} to create the
     57 package's @file{config.h.in} include file template.
     58 
     59 The name @samp{autopoint} is an abbreviation of @samp{auto-po-intl-m4};
     60 the tool copies or updates mostly files in the @file{po}, @file{intl},
     61 @file{m4} directories.
